Background
The electric heating pot is a cooking appliance for converting electric energy into heat energy, and can realize various cooking modes such as frying, steaming, boiling, stewing, braising and the like. Electric cookers are classified into electric frying pans, electric stewpots, electric steamers, electric cookers, electric chafing dishes, and the like according to different cooking modes. Most of the electric rice cookers heat and cook rice in a cooking mode, that is, water and rice are put into a cooker body together, and the rice is cooked by heating and evaporating the water. Therefore, a novel electric rice cooker for making rice in a steaming manner is provided, and the existing electric rice cooker for steaming rice generally comprises an outer cooker and an inner cooker, wherein the upper edge of the outer cooker is buckled with a bracket which supports the inner cooker through the bracket, the bracket comprises an upper bracket and a lower bracket, the upper bracket and the lower bracket respectively clamp the upper edge of the outer cooker from the upper side and the lower side of the upper edge of the outer cooker and are buckled together, the bracket with the structure is complex in assembly and relatively high in production cost, and a gap exists between the upper bracket and the lower bracket, so that the cleaning is difficult.

Referring to fig. 1-3, the present invention provides a cooking device, which may be an electric cooker, an electric stewpan, or other electric heating device, and will be described below by way of example with reference to an electric cooker. It can be understood that the cooking appliance may have various functions such as cooking porridge, cooking soup, etc. in addition to the function of cooking rice.
The cooking utensil comprises a pot body 1, an inner pot 12 and a cover body 2. The cooking utensil is approximately cylindrical in shape, and the pot body 1 comprises a shell 10 and an outer pot 11 fixed in the shell 10. The inner pot 12 can be freely put into the outer pot 11 or taken out of the outer pot 11, thereby being convenient for cleaning. The cover body 2 is arranged on the shell 10 of the pot body 1 in an openable and closable manner, and when the cover body 2 covers the pot body 1, a cooking space is formed between the cover body 2 and the outer pot 11. The cover body 2 can also be provided with a sealing ring which is arranged between the cover body 2 and the outer pot 11 and used for sealing the cooking space when the cover body 2 covers the pot body 1.
In order to ensure that steam can circulate to the inner pot 12 for steaming rice, a steam passage 101 is provided between the inner pot 12 and the outer pot 11, and the steam passage 101 communicates the inner space of the outer pot 11 with the inner space of the inner pot 12 for supplying steam from the outer pot 11 into the inner pot 12. When cooking, the outer pot 11 contains water, the inner pot 12 contains rice, and when the water in the outer pot 11 is heated to form water vapor, the water vapor flows from the outer pot 11 to the inner pot 12 through the vapor passage 101, so that the rice in the inner pot 12 is heated. According to the cooking utensil, rice is cooked in a steaming mode, raw rice can fully absorb water vapor to form full rice grains, and the rice tastes better. Moreover, delicious rice can be prepared without strictly controlling the proportion of water to rice, so that the rice is simpler to use and is suitable for various types of consumers.
In order to support the inner pot 12, a support part 111 is convexly arranged at the bottom of the outer pot 11 towards the inner pot 12, and the support part 111 supports the inner pot 12 in the outer pot 11. In this embodiment, since the outer pot 11 is provided with the supporting portion 111, that is, the supporting portion 111 is directly formed on the outer pot 11, the step of assembling the supporting structure can be omitted, the structure is simple, the cleaning is easy, the processing is easy, and thus the cost of the production and the processing can be reduced. When the inner pot 12 is used, the inner pot 12 is directly placed on the supporting portion 111, the assembly of the inner pot 12 does not have high precision requirements, the production and processing cost can be reduced, the inner pot 12 can be taken out conveniently, and the inner pot 12 can be taken out to be cleaned.
Referring to fig. 4 and 5, the supporting portion 111 is a protrusion integrally formed with the outer pot 11, and the structure is simple and stable. In this embodiment, the supporting portion 111 connects the side wall and the bottom wall of the outer pot 11, that is, the portion of the side wall of the outer pot 11 connecting the bottom wall protrudes toward the inside of the outer pot 11 to form the supporting portion 111. The supporting part 111 has a top surface and a side surface, and the top surface and the side surface of the supporting part 111 are connected through an arc curved surface, so that the supporting part 111 can be prevented from scratching the inner pot 12. The top surface of the supporting portion 111 supports the inner pan 12, and further, the top surface of the supporting portion 111 is an inclined surface inclined from the side wall of the outer pan 11 toward the central region, so that the top surfaces of the supporting portions 111 cooperate to form an approximately funnel-shaped supporting structure, and the supporting portion 111 can support the inner pan 12 more stably, and such a shape is easier to process. Specifically, the shape of the protrusion may be a square shape having rounded corners, and the upper end of the square shape may support the inner pan 12 more stably. The supporting portion 111 can be formed by die-casting or stamping, the die-casting or stamping process is mature, the processing process is simple, and the control of the production cost is facilitated.
The quantity of supporting part 111 is a plurality of, and a plurality of supporting part 111 intervals set up, can avoid supporting part 111 to separate the disconnection with the space in 12 outsides of interior pot in the space of 12 below of pot to pot 12 below has had enough water level space in having guaranteed, and has guaranteed the intercommunication in steam channel 101 and interior pot 12 below water level space. In this embodiment, the number of the supporting portions 111 is three, and the three supporting portions 111 can stably support the inner pan 12. Of course, the number of the supporting portions 111 may be other numbers.
The inner wall circumference of a plurality of supporting parts 111 edge outer pot 11 evenly arranges, and then the size of the interval between a plurality of supporting parts 111 is the same, sets up like this, except can stably supporting interior pot 12, still can ensure the steam homodisperse more of interior pot 12 week side, avoids the rice of different positions to be heated the inhomogeneous condition.
Referring to fig. 2-5, the side wall of the outer pot 11 is convexly provided with a plurality of limiting portions 112,
the plurality of limiting parts 112 are arranged at intervals along the circumferential direction of the outer pot 11, and the side wall of the outer pot 11 and the side wall of the inner wall 12 are spaced by the limiting parts 112, so that the steam channel 101 is formed between the adjacent limiting parts 112, steam can pass through the steam channel, and sufficient ventilation quantity is ensured. The structure for forming the steam channel 101 is very simple and easy to process. When placing interior pot 12, can put into outer pot 11 with interior pot 12 from between a plurality of spacing portions 112, the mobilizable space of interior pot 12 has been restricted to a plurality of spacing portions 112, makes interior pot 12 can accurately place on supporting part 111, and the condition of slope can not appear. Preferably, the position-limiting part 112 is arranged at a position of the outer pot 11 close to the pot edge, so that the inner pot 12 can be conveniently put into the outer pot 11 from among the position-limiting parts 112, and of course, the position-limiting part 112 can also be arranged at a position of the outer pot 11 close to the middle part. In this embodiment, the number of the limiting portions 112 is three, and the three limiting portions 112 can perform a better limiting function. Of course, the number of the stopper portions 112 may be other numbers.
Furthermore, the limiting part 112 is a projection integrally formed with the outer pot 11, and has simple structure, good stability and easy processing. The shape of the protrusion may be a rectangle with rounded corners, and the length direction of the protrusion is the same as the height direction of the outer pot 11. The design with rounded corners avoids scratching the inner pan 12 and is easier to machine. The length direction is the same as the height direction of the outer pot 11, which is beneficial to limiting the inner pot 12 and avoiding the inner pot 12 from inclining. The limiting part 112 can be formed by die-casting or stamping, the die-casting or stamping process is very mature, the processing process is simple, and the control of the production cost is facilitated. In this embodiment, the limiting portion 112 and the supporting portion 111 are located on the same vertical line of the sidewall of the outer pot 11, which is beneficial to processing and has an attractive appearance. But not limited thereto, the position-limiting part 112 and the supporting part 111 may not be located on the same vertical line of the side wall of the outer pot 11.
Further, a gap is formed between the limiting portion 112 and the outer wall of the inner pot 12, so that the inner pot 12 can be taken and placed more smoothly, and the limiting portion 112 can be prevented from scratching the outer wall of the inner pot 12.
Referring to fig. 2 and 3, the cooking utensil further includes a heating element 3, and the heating element 3 is fixedly disposed at the bottom of the outer pot 11. The heating assembly 3 heats the outer pot 11 to cook rice. Specifically, the heat generating component 3 may include a heat generating plate 31 and a heat generating tube 32. The heating tube 32 is disposed in the heating plate 31 or below the heating plate 31. The heating tube 32 converts electric energy into heat energy for supplying heat, and the heating plate 31 can make the heat generation more uniform. The heating plate 31 can be arranged close to the bottom of the outer pot 11, for example, the heating plate 31 is welded at the bottom of the outer pot 11, so that heat can be directly transferred to the outer pot 11, and the heating efficiency is higher. In this embodiment, the outer pot 11 is fixed in the housing 10 and cannot be taken out, so as to avoid the problem of potential safety hazard caused by the exposed heating component 3.
In order to realize the electrification and normal use of the heating component 3, the cooking appliance further comprises an upper connector 4 capable of realizing the transmission of electric energy and signals, wherein the upper connector 4 is arranged in the shell 10 and is electrically connected with the heating component 3. In addition, the cooking appliance further includes a power base 5, as shown in fig. 6, the power base 5 has a lower connector 51, a control circuit board (not shown), and a power connector (not shown), and both the lower connector 51 and the power connector are electrically connected to the control circuit board. The power connector is used for connecting a mains supply interface so as to switch on a power supply, the lower connector 51 is matched with the upper connector 4, and the transmission of electric energy and signals can be realized through the connection between the lower connector 51 and the upper connector 4. During the use, connect connector 51 down with upper connector 4 and can realize the circular telegram of heating element 3 to heating element 3 carries out normal work and turns into heat energy with the electric energy thereby heats outer pot 11. Go up connector 4 and can set up in the bottom of the pot body 1, lower connector 51 sets up in power base 5's top, then only need align last connector 4 and place and can realize heating element 3's normal circular telegram on lower connector 51, and the operation is very simple, and it is very convenient to use. The upper connector 4 and the lower connector 51 can be provided as coupling connectors, which is safer and more reliable.
